If you're an avid golfer, you're probably always looking for ways to improve your game. One often overlooked tool that can help you level up your golf game is accurate handicap tracking. Keeping track of your handicap is essential for a number of reasons, and can provide numerous benefits to your overall golfing experience.

One of the biggest benefits of accurate golf handicap tracking is that it allows you to accurately measure your skill level. Your handicap is a numerical representation of your golfing ability, and it is determined by comparing your scores to the course rating and slope rating of the courses you play. By tracking your handicap over time, you can see how your skill level is improving or if there are areas of your game that need work. This self-awareness can help you set goals and focus your practice sessions on specific areas that need improvement.

Accurate handicap tracking also provides a level playing field when you're competing against other golfers. Handicaps are used to level the playing field in golf tournaments and matches, allowing players of different skill levels to compete against each other fairly. By accurately tracking your handicap, you can ensure that you're being matched up against players of a similar skill level, increasing the competitiveness and fairness of the game.
